Eaton UPS Battery Replacement — Easy Battery+ / Battery+ Summary
Significance of the topic
Batteries are the central and most service-sensitive component of uninterruptible power systems (UPS). Reliable battery performance determines the available runtime, system resilience during power disturbances and overall lifecycle cost of UPS installations. Practical service approaches that minimise downtime, improve safety and make battery replacement predictable are therefore critical for data centres, industrial sites and critical infrastructure.

Methodology and used instrumentation
Methodology (service concept): Eaton supplies complete battery trays or certified loose battery packs tailored to each UPS model. Replacement is designed to be performed quickly and safely by removing the UPS front panel and swapping the tray—without shutting down the UPS or load (hot-swap). Each battery pack is shipped with safety notices and installation guidance (videos accessible via QR code). Eaton recommends replacing the battery tray around every four years or earlier if operating conditions (notably elevated temperature) accelerate degradation.
Used instrumentation (product coverage and examples):
- Broad compatibility across Eaton product lines including 5P, 5PX, 5SC, 9PX, 9SX, 9130, 5130, EX / Pulsar M, 3S, Ellipse families and Protection Station models.
- Model-specific replacement references (examples): EB001SP/EB001WEB for 5SC 3000i RT2U and related models; EB006SP/EB006WEB for 9SX 5000i/6000i and 9PX 5000/6000 HotSwap; EBP-1613I and related EBP kits for multiple 5PX/9PX RT2U and RT3U variations.
- Battery types and nominal cells: mostly 12 V lead-acid sealed batteries (commonly 9 Ah and variations of 5 Ah and 7 Ah), also 6 V variants for some packs. Battery pack voltages in the range ~12 V to 180 V depending on model/configuration.
Key technical specifications (high-level summary)
- Common cell: 12 V 9 Ah is the most frequent battery in the kits; other sizes include 12 V 5 Ah, 12 V 7 Ah and 6 V 9 Ah variants.
- Pack voltages: typical battery pack voltages include 12 V, 24 V, 36 V, 48 V, 60 V, 72 V, 96 V and up to 180 V depending on model and number of cells.
- Form factors: trays are supplied in a variety of dimensions to fit rack and tower form factors; weights range from ~1.95 kg up to ~28.25 kg in the datasheet entries.
- Warranty: each replacement kit is supplied with a one-year warranty as standard.
Main results and discussion
The Eaton Easy Battery+ approach produces several operational advantages demonstrated in the datasheet:
- Speed and safety: replacing a complete battery tray is faster and safer than swapping individual cells, reducing technician exposure to repetitive manual work and the chance of wiring mistakes.
- Hot-swap capability: many supported UPS models allow tray exchange without powering down the UPS or the protected load, minimising planned downtime and preserving continuous operation for critical systems.
- Design for serviceability: Eaton configured chassis and front-panel access to permit straightforward tray removal and insertion, simplifying logistics for on-site service.
- Lifecycle management: Eaton recommends proactive tray replacement (for example after four years) to maintain runtime and reduce the risk of in-service battery failure—especially in installations where ambient temperatures exceed ~30 °C and shorten battery life.
- Safety and compliance: each pack includes safety instructions; Eaton provides installation videos to support correct procedures.
Benefits and practical applications
- Operational continuity: rapid tray swaps and hot-swap support make this solution suitable for data centres, edge computing sites, telecom shelters and industrial control rooms where uptime is critical.
- Service efficiency: technicians can perform replacements with fewer steps, reducing mean-time-to-repair (MTTR) and labour costs.
- Inventory simplification: standardized replacement kits tied to UPS model references ease parts management and procurement for maintenance contracts.
- Risk reduction: pre-tested and certified battery packs lower the chance of mismatched or degraded cells being installed, improving system reliability and safety.
